Playa Santa Cruz is a beautiful beach located in Altagracia (Municipio), Nicaragua. The beach is about 1 km long and has golden sand that contrasts with the turquoise waters of the Pacific Ocean.
There are no lifeguards on duty at the beach, but bathroom access is available
Playa Santa Cruz offers various activities such as swimming, sunbathing, beach volleyball, surfing, and boogie boarding.
There is a parking lot available at Playa Santa Cruz, and it is free of charge. The parking lot is conveniently located just a short walk from the beach, so visitors can easily access the beach from their vehicles.
Fun fact about Playa Santa Cruz: This beach is a nesting site for Olive Ridley sea turtles, and it is possible to observe them during the nesting season, which is from August to December.
Playa Santa Cruz is situated close to several tourist attractions, such as the Ojo de Agua natural pool, Charco Verde ecological reserve, and the pre-Columbian pottery museum. Visitors can also hike in the nearby Maderas volcano.
There are a few restaurants near Playa Santa Cruz that offer various cuisines, such as seafood, Nicaraguan, and international dishes. Some of the notable restaurants include Restaurante Punta Teonoste, Bahía del Sol, and El Chiringuito.
There are several hotels in the area for visitors who want to spend a night or two near Playa Santa Cruz. The closest hotel is Hotel Villa Paraíso, which is located just a few meters away from the beach. Another option is the Hotel Xalli, which is also nearby and offers comfortable accommodations for visitors.
